I was reading an article by Dr. Oz this morning and thought you might enjoy it too. It gives good advice on how to be healthy and to expect failure, but also what to do when you hit the bump in the road. Here is the article:
"Here are the five most important things a person can do to undo holiday damage:
#1 Start walking today.
#2 Tell people. Go public about your goals and get enablers who reinforce your bad habits out of the way.
#3 Sleep. If you sleep the 7 hours you’re supposed to, you won’t crave carbs as much.
#4 Trick your body. Fool yourself when you’re hungry by drinking water instead or eating or eating simple things like mints that "blow out your taste buds." It works.
#5 Automate your life. Eat the same healthy option for breakfast. Bring a healthy lunch to work every day. Keep snacks like nuts in your pockets, your desk, anywhere that’s in easy reach, so you will never feel hungry. That, he says, is the real key to weight loss.
There are certain “power” foods that we should all be eating more of. Foods
that “come out of the ground looking exactly the way they look when we eat
them,” he notes. These include antioxidant-rich vegetables, blueberries,
apples, whole grains with lots of fiber and spicy foods!
*An interesting tip: if you eat spicy foods for breakfast, you won’t eat as much
at lunch.
There are also food we should start avoiding like the plague: trans fats (processed foods have lots) and saturated fats and anything with high-fructose corn syrup, especially soda. When you drink soda, he explains, it actually makes you hungrier and you end up eating more calories.
Muscle-building exercise is also key to undoing damage, as muscles burn calories even between workouts. This is even more important for women, says Dr. Oz, because we generally have less muscle mass than men.
One other important thing to keep in mind— expect to fail. The main reason we fall off the rails this time of year, he says, is because we think we have to be perfect which, of course, is impossible. If we slip up, we should simply do as our GPS tell us when we miss a street, “make the first authorized U-turn” and get back with the program."

I read an article about "How to keep your New Year's Resolutions: Advice from the Experts." I think I might be in trouble...here is number 5:
"5. Get Better Friends
Consciously and unconsciously, people tend to imitate those around them. That's why the latest research shows that things like happiness, quitting smoking and obesity can spread like a contagion through social networks. So, surround yourself with friends who can also be role models. "Make sure that people you hang out with are people who look and act the way you would like to. Social imitation is the easiest form not only of flattery but of self-improvement," says Stanton Peele, author of Seven Tools to Beat Addiction. (Read "In Old Age, Friends Can Keep You Young. Really.")
Social support is critical to changing all kinds of behavior. Good friends can not only help you through slip-ups, but they can also help keep your New Year's resolution from taking over your life. Rather than obsessing about what you shouldn't be doing, think about things you should, experts say. The distraction will help you curb bad habits. "Focus on your higher goals and positive activities, things that both sustain you and fill your life," says Peele. If you regularly engage in meaningful activities that give you pleasure - whether it's visiting friends, picking up a hobby, taking a class or doing volunteer work (one of the most overlooked sources of personal joy and meaning is helping others) - you'll simply have less time to crave or engage in the behavior that you want to reduce."
